What Is a DAC and Why Is It Essential for Audio Quality?

Key aspects of DACs include their sampling rate and bit depth, both of which determine the quality of the audio output. The sampling rate refers to how many times per second the audio signal is sampled, with higher rates allowing for better resolution and detail in the sound. Bit depth affects the dynamic range of the audio, with higher bit depths providing greater detail in both the quiet and loud parts of the sound. These technical specifications are crucial for audiophiles who seek the best listening experience and can differentiate between average and high-end audio equipment.

How Can You Set Up and Optimize an American Made DAC for Best Results?

To set up and optimize an American made DAC for the best audio results, consider the following steps:

  • Choose the Right Location: The placement of your DAC is crucial for optimal performance. Keep it away from electronic devices that may cause interference, and ensure adequate ventilation to prevent overheating.
  • Use High-Quality Cables: Investing in quality cables can significantly affect audio fidelity. Use well-shielded and properly terminated cables to minimize signal loss and maintain sound integrity.
  • Connect to Quality Audio Sources: Pair your DAC with high-resolution audio sources. Streaming services and files that support high-quality formats (like FLAC or WAV) will ensure that the DAC can perform to its fullest potential.
  • Adjust Your Settings: Many DACs come with adjustable settings for sample rates and filters. Experiment with these settings to find the configuration that sounds best to you, as different music genres may benefit from specific adjustments.
  • Regular Firmware Updates: Check for firmware updates from the manufacturer. These updates can improve performance, fix bugs, and add new features, ensuring that your DAC remains at peak performance.
  • Incorporate a Quality Amplifier: Pairing your DAC with a high-quality amplifier can enhance sound quality. The amplifier will help drive your speakers or headphones effectively, making the most of the DAC’s capabilities.
  • Optimize Your Listening Environment: The acoustics of your room can affect sound quality. Use sound-absorbing materials like rugs and curtains, and experiment with speaker placement to create a more balanced soundstage.
  • Utilize Digital Signal Processing if Available: Some DACs offer built-in DSP options. Make use of these features to tailor the sound profile according to your preferences, adjusting for bass, treble, and other audio characteristics.
